Persistence of dangerous abortion

Inspite of the recognized fall in abortion-related maternal death and a reduction inside most dangerous ways of clandestinely inducing termination, unsafe termination stays widespread. Although unsafe abortions try not to produce dying, could bring harm and distress that can get long-term aftermath. Unfortuitously, morbidity from hazardous termination is still typical, inspite of the accessibility to safe and secure MR solutions. As of 2010, Bangladeshi females risked their own health with clandestine abortions for a price of 18 per 1,000 people every year. 20 as very same 12 months, around 231,000 lady gotten procedures at a health service for problems of dangerous abortion. Additionally, as reported by the perceptions of participants to your survey of medical experts this year (view system in reference 20), no more than 40% of all the women who demanded treatment plan for abortion complications actually acquired they. In other words an additional 341,000 female developed issues but decided not to receive practices, indicating that told, approximately 572,000 Bangladeshi female experienced issues from dangerous abortions this season.

That MRs is comparatively safer, in comparison with harmful abortions, is apparent as soon as we examine their particular results. One example is, the interest rate when MR complications happen to be dealt with in an overall health establishment simply one-third that of clandestine abortion problems (2.2 vs. 6.5 cases managed per 1,000 lady elderly 15a€“44 age; stand 3). More over, whereas for virtually any 1,000 MRs being performed each and every year, about 120 bring about issues being handled in health areas, the comparable percentage for clandestine abortions concerns 360 per 1,000 abortions.

Along with the health result of clandestine abortions, their particular economic prices are likewise considerable. Gurus questioned inside 2010 health care professionals Survey approximate that in non-urban destinations, the best clandestine abortionsa€”those given by health doctorsa€”cost 500a€“1,100 taka. 28 impart this economic weight into viewpoint, a standard every month per capita revenues in outlying elements of Bangladesh is definitely about 2,000 taka. 29 Prices for clandestine abortions tends to be calculated for higher still in towns, with a physician-provided abortion costing 900a€“2,100 taka in places where an average monthly per capita revenues are 3,741 taka. 29

Beating obstacles to MR

Why do Bangladeshi ladies carry on and unjustifiably exposure their own health and being by means of a clandestine abortion as soon as safe and reasonably priced MR techniques are available? Below we analyze some of the hurdles female may come across if attempting to obtain an MR. Most of us also have a look at restrictions throughout the system which can be reducing womena€™s the means to access, and timely the application of, the service.

Restricted provision

One-third of business which happen to be likely providers of MR services cannot present them simply because they lack often the standard machines or experienced associate, or both (desk 2). Possibly even better scary, most facilities which do have actually properly prepared personnel together with the necessity gear continue to be not just giving this government-sanctioned solution. The endurance of such gaps substantially brings down womena€™s gain access to, and break are specially wide in private-sector clinics.

The reasons behind this unexploited possibilities happened to be suggested at when you look at the replies to an extra query requested of UH&FWCs merely. Among workforce surveyed at UH&FWCs that didn’t supply MR services, 43percent mentioned religious or personal factors behind not just doing this, 37% mentioned that objectives about their very own fitness stop all of them from offering the service, and 24per cent just believed they just don’t choose carry out the method. As well as, approximately 10% each sharp to insufficient MR education, inadequate MR supply, low place and the lack of support team. That about four in 10 FWCsa€”the premises kind providing the greatest proportion of all MRsa€”cited a€?social or religiousa€? factors or personal preference for maybe not offer MRs is an important indicator of really need to far better learn following directly fix these factors.

Rejection by MR services

Lots of women cannot acquire an MR since they are changed aside for one. The research found that about one-quarter of business asking for an MR, or 166,000 ladies, were denied the task this year. 20 Once establishments comprise need the reason these people declined requests for MRs, almost every stated that surely his or her good reasons for this got because people comprise higher than the optimal allowed months since the company’s LMP (number 3 ). This factor happens to be clear granted guidelines on LMP controls. Equally, health related rationale (in other words., a clienta€™s preexisting medical problem), offered no strings attached dating by around 50 % of facilities, could be understandable also, although particulars include inaccessible. Sorry to say, some other good reasons for converting out MR people, though mentioned by littler proportions of facilities, are generally growth relying for that reason rise above any instructions or needs. Examples of these are a woman not quite yet using any offspring (mentioned by 20 percent) and looking at a girl to become too-young (by 12percent).
